
After continuous Israeli attacks on Hamas targets, it seems that the terrorist organization has become nervous. For the first time after the bloody conflict between the two since October 7, Hamas has released a video. This video has been made by Hamas for blackmailing to stop the bombing.
Terrorist organization Hamas has released a video of a 21-year-old girl Mia Shem being held hostage. The girl in the video is very scared. But she seems to be saying that she is completely fine. He is being treated by Hamas.
It is believed that Hamas has made this video with the intention of blackmailing. Through this video, he wants to tell all the countries that Israel is attacking them and is taking care of the victims. As if his image is being created in front of the world. That is not the reality.
According to an Israeli media report, Hamas has released Mia Shem's video on its Arabic Telegram channel. The video shows a Hamas commander giving medical treatment to the girl. In the video, the girl is seen saying that she was injured in the attack. But now he is fine. He is being treated by Hamas.
